LETTER FROM THE FAMILY:
Dear Homes of Hope team, I am a mother of three children. Four years ago, my father passed away, and since then, we have been living with my mother and sister, as I separated from my partner due to his increasingly violent behavior. We met at work and, after three years together, decided to live as a family. I continued working while my mother cared for the children, but eventually, we decided that I would stay home to focus on their education. After my father’s passing, tensions between my partner and my family grew unbearable, putting me in a very difficult position. We moved to a house provided by his parents, but he no longer allowed me to see my family. After the pandemic, he lost his job and we both tried to get by selling whatever we could. Although his family supported us, he became more aggressive until, with the help of a friend, I managed to escape. I returned to my mother’s home, where we now live with the support of each other, the widow’s pension, and my sister’s income—she even left school to work. The house is very small, with only two rooms, one bathroom, and a shared space for the stove, refrigerator, and dining table. Recently, I found out I’m pregnant again—something unexpected but which I now see as a blessing. For this reason, I humbly ask for your support in helping us build a dignified home for my children. I truly thank you for allowing me to share my story.
